Analysis
In 2025, cpi: national consumer price index, percentage change from previous in Senegal stood at 1.46.
The figure is up 82.5% on the previous year and up 942.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, cpi: national consumer price index, percentage change from previous in Senegal peaked at 9.7 in 2022 and was at its lowest, -2.25, in 2009.
That places Senegal 140th out of 193 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
CPI: National consumer price index, percentage change from previous in Senegal,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2001 | 2.97 | — |
| 2002 | 2.34 | -21.2% |
| 2003 | -0.05 | -102.1% |
| 2004 | 0.51 | -1120.0% |
| 2005 | 1.71 | +235.3% |
| 2006 | 2.11 | +23.4% |
| 2007 | 5.85 | +177.3% |
| 2008 | 7.35 | +25.6% |
| 2009 | -2.25 | -130.6% |
| 2010 | 1.23 | -154.7% |
| 2011 | 3.4 | +176.4% |
| 2012 | 1.42 | -58.2% |
| 2013 | 0.71 | -50.0% |
| 2014 | -1.09 | -253.5% |
| 2015 | 0.14 | -112.8% |
| 2016 | 0.84 | +500.0% |
| 2017 | 1.32 | +57.1% |
| 2018 | 0.46 | -65.2% |
| 2019 | 1.76 | +282.6% |
| 2020 | 2.54 | +44.3% |
| 2021 | 2.18 | -14.2% |
| 2022 | 9.7 | +345.0% |
| 2023 | 5.94 | -38.8% |
| 2024 | 0.8 | -86.5% |
| 2025 | 1.46 | +82.5% |

About this data
This indicator shows the percentage change of the CPI between a period and the same period of the previous year. Data are disaggregated by the Classification of Individual Consumption According to Purpose (COICOP).
